Introduction to Hydraulic Ball Valves
Hydraulic ball valves are crucial components in various fluid control systems, serving a vital function in regulating flow. These valves utilize a spherical disc, or ball, to obstruct or allow fluid passage, making them highly efficient and reliable. Understanding their significance is essential for professionals in industries ranging from manufacturing to oil and gas.
Understanding Hydraulic Ball Valves
Hydraulic ball valves are designed to provide a quick and reliable shut-off mechanism. Their construction typically includes a ball with a hole through its center, which aligns with the flow path when the valve is open. The body of the valve is generally made from robust materials such as stainless steel, brass, or PVC, ensuring durability under high pressure and various environmental conditions.
The Structure of Hydraulic Ball Valves
The primary components of a hydraulic ball valve include:
- **Ball**: The core mechanism that controls flow.
- **Seats**: These are positioned on either side of the ball and provide a sealing surface.
- **Body**: The outer shell that houses the ball and the seats.
- **Stem**: Connects the ball to the actuator or handle, allowing for manual or automatic operation.
Types of Hydraulic Ball Valves
Several types of ball valves exist, each tailored for specific applications:
- **Standard Ball Valves**: Ideal for general use in pipelines.
- **Trunnion Ball Valves**: Suitable for high-pressure applications, featuring a mounted ball for added stability.
- **Floating Ball Valves**: Utilized in lower pressure systems, where the ball is held in place by the pressure of the fluid.
How Hydraulic Ball Valves Work
The operation of hydraulic ball valves is straightforward yet effective. **When the valve is opened**, the ball rotates to align the hole with the flow path, allowing fluid to pass through. Conversely, **when the valve is closed**, the ball rotates 90 degrees to block the flow completely. This simple mechanism allows for rapid flow control, making hydraulic ball valves a popular choice in various applications.
Actuation Methods
Hydraulic ball valves can be operated in several ways:
- **Manual Actuation**: Commonly used in smaller systems where operators can easily reach the valve.
- **Electric Actuation**: Ideal for remote control, enabling automation and integration with larger systems.
- **Pneumatic Actuation**: Utilizes compressed air to operate the valve, suitable for high-speed applications.
Advantages of Hydraulic Ball Valves in Fluid Control
Hydraulic ball valves offer numerous benefits, making them a preferred choice for many industries:
- **Quick Operation**: The 90-degree turn provides immediate shut-off or flow, reducing downtime.
- **Minimal Pressure Drop**: The design allows for efficient flow with minimal resistance.
- **Durability**: Made from high-quality materials, they can withstand harsh conditions and have a long service life.
- **Leak-Free Operation**: Properly maintained ball valves can achieve excellent sealing, preventing leaks.
- **Versatility**: Suitable for a wide range of fluids, including gases, liquids, and slurries.
Applications of Hydraulic Ball Valves in Industry
Hydraulic ball valves are extensively used across various sectors:
- **Oil and Gas Industry**: For controlling the flow of crude oil and natural gas in pipelines.
- **Water Treatment Facilities**: Regulating water supply and waste management processes.
- **Chemical Processing**: Handling corrosive substances safely and efficiently.
- **Power Generation**: Managing steam and cooling water systems in power plants.
- **Manufacturing**: Controlling fluid flow in hydraulic systems used for machinery and equipment.
Maintenance and Care for Hydraulic Ball Valves
Regular maintenance is essential to ensure that hydraulic ball valves function optimally:
- **Routine Inspections**: Regularly check for leaks, rust, and other signs of wear.
- **Lubrication**: Apply appropriate lubricants to the stem and seating surfaces as per the manufacturer’s guidelines.
- **Cleaning**: Keep the exterior of the valve clean to prevent corrosion and damage.
- **Testing**: Perform operational tests to ensure that the valve opens and closes smoothly.
Troubleshooting Common Issues with Hydraulic Ball Valves
Despite their reliability, issues can arise with hydraulic ball valves. Here are some common problems and solutions:
- **Valve Fails to Open or Close**: Check for obstructions or mechanical failures.
- **Leakage**: Inspect seals and seats for wear and replace them as necessary.
- **Operating Difficulties**: Ensure that the actuator or manual handle is functioning correctly and that there is no blockage.
Frequently Asked Questions
1. What materials are hydraulic ball valves made from?
Hydraulic ball valves can be made from various materials, including stainless steel, brass, and plastic, depending on the application and the fluid being controlled.
2. How often should hydraulic ball valves be maintained?
It is advisable to conduct maintenance checks at least once a year, but more frequent checks may be necessary depending on the operating conditions.
3. Can hydraulic ball valves handle high-pressure applications?
Yes, certain types of hydraulic ball valves, such as trunnion-mounted ball valves, are specifically designed for high-pressure environments.
4. What are the signs of a failing ball valve?
Common signs include leakage, difficulty in operation, and unusual noises during operation.
5. How do I choose the right hydraulic ball valve for my application?
Consider factors such as the type of fluid, temperature, pressure, and the specific requirements of your application to choose the suitable valve.
